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et

Extracto de la hoja de repaso

📋 Plan du Cours

  1. Commandes Git pour la gestion des branches et des commits
  2. Utilisation de Criterion pour les tests unitaires en C
  3. Déclaration et utilisation des pointeurs de fonction en C
  4. Concepts de multiprocessus en programmation
  5. Lexing et parsing en analyse syntaxique

📖 1. Commandes Git pour la gestion des branches et des commits

🔑 Notions clés & Définitions

  • branche : ligne de développement séparée dans Git, créée et manipulée par des commandes comme git switch -c ou git branch -D.
  • commit : enregistrement d’un état du travail dans l’historique, que l’on peut modifier avec git commit --amend ou appliquer depuis une autre branche avec git cherry-pick <commit-hash>.
  • Combine deux branches avec : opération de fusion qui réunit deux branches ; la source associe cette idée à git rebase dans la proposition « Combine deux branches avec un merge commit », mais la bonne réponse indiquée est le rejet de cette formulation au profit du rebase.
  • deux branches avec un merge : fusion de deux branches par une opération de merge ; la source la distingue du rebase, qui ne crée pas de merge commit.
  • branches avec un merge commit : résultat d’une fusion qui produit un commit de merge ; la source précise que git rebase ne correspond pas à cela.
Lee la hoja completa →

Vista previa del cuestionario

1. Quel effet le parsing a-t-il sur l’entrée après le découpage en tokens ?

2. Quel effet a le fait de lier Criterion à un programme ?

3. Quel est le rôle de typedef dans ce contexte de pointeur de fonction en C ?

Realiza el cuestionario (5 preguntas) →

Vista previa de las tarjetas de memoria

Git — créer une branche ?

`git switch -c` ou `git branch -D` pour supprimer

Commit — enregistrement ?

Sauvegarde de l’état du travail

`git rebase` — rôle ?

Rejoue les commits sur une autre branche

`git stash` — fonction ?

Met de côté modifications non commitées

Pointeur de fonction — déclaration ?

`int (*op)(int, int)`

Affectation pointeur — syntaxe valide ?

`op = add` ou `op = &add`

Ver las 10 tarjetas de memoria →

Preguntas frecuentes

¿Qué cubre la hoja de repaso sobre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et?

La hoja de repaso cubre los conceptos esenciales de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et. Está organizada por temas para facilitar el aprendizaje y la memorización, con definiciones clave, explicaciones y resúmenes.

Lee la hoja completa →

¿Cuántas preguntas tiene el cuestionario de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et?

El cuestionario contiene 5 preguntas de opción múltiple con correcciones y explicaciones detalladas para cada respuesta. Ideal para poner a prueba tus conocimientos e identificar lagunas.

Realiza el cuestionario (5 preguntas) →

¿Cómo estudiar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et con tarjetas de memoria?

Revizly ofrece 10 tarjetas de memoria interactivas sobre Introduction aux commandes Git, tests unitaires en C, pointeurs de fonction, multiprocessus et. Cada tarjeta presenta una pregunta en el anverso y la respuesta en el reverso, permitiendo una revisión activa y efectiva basada en la repetición espaciada.

Ver las 10 tarjetas de memoria →

Similar courses

Create your own sheets from your courses

Import your PDF or paste your course, AI generates sheets, quizzes and flashcards in 30 seconds.